R E S O L U T I O N
         WHEREAS, The Texas House of Representatives is pleased to
  recognize Tressie Bates for her outstanding work in the office of
  Representative Barbara Mallory Caraway during the 81st Legislative
  Session; and
         WHEREAS, Ms. Bates has distinguished herself as a participant
  in the Texas Legislative Internship Program (TLIP) administered by
  the Mickey Leland Center on World Hunger and Peace at Texas Southern
  University; and
         WHEREAS, Established in 1990, TLIP provides a unique
  opportunity for students from Texas colleges and universities to
  serve as interns in the Texas Legislature, in state agencies, and in
  local government offices; students receive academic credit for
  participating in the program, which combines study and research
  with supervised practical training; Senator Rodney Ellis serves as
  a program advisor, and his office assists with coordinating on-site
  activities; and
         WHEREAS, A junior at Baylor University, Ms. Bates is majoring
  in political science and business administration; she has
  previously worked as an intern with the attorney general's office
  in Waco and has further shared her time as a volunteer at North Waco
  Elementary School and the Waco Family Abuse Center; after
  graduation, she plans to attend law school; and
         WHEREAS, During her tenure as a legislative intern, Ms. Bates
  has gained valuable work experience and firsthand knowledge of the
  governmental process, while also developing insight into the
  important issues facing our communities and our state; and
         WHEREAS, Diligent and resourceful, Ms. Bates has skillfully
  handled a variety of duties in the office of Representative Mallory
  Caraway and ably assisted in meeting the needs of constituents, and
  she may reflect proudly on her service as a legislative intern; now,
  therefore, be it
         R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 81st Texas
  Legislature hereby commend Tressie Bates for her tireless
  dedication and exemplary work as a participant in the Texas
  Legislative Internship Program and extend to her sincere best
  wishes for the future; and, be it further
         R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
  prepared for Ms. Bates as an expression of high regard by the Texas
  House of Representatives.
